How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Spring?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Spring Studio Apartments | $895 | $354 | $2,496 |
Spring 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,357 | $394 | $3,986 |
Spring 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,746 | $458 | $5,135 |
Spring 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,087 | $1,218 | $7,306 |
Spring 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,414 | $1,438 | $7,000 |
